Description
Two Little Pilgrims’ Progress by Frances Hodgson Burnett is a charming and reflective children’s story inspired by the moral and allegorical tradition of John Bunyan’s Pilgrim’s Progress. Through a gentle and imaginative narrative, Burnett presents a story that combines childhood innocence with deeper reflections on character, kindness, and personal growth.
The story follows two young children who embark on their own symbolic “pilgrimage” through everyday experiences. As they encounter various situations and characters along the way, the children learn lessons about courage, patience, generosity, and moral responsibility. Burnett skillfully transforms ordinary moments into meaningful opportunities for reflection, making the story both engaging and instructive.
Written in Burnett’s warm and accessible style, the narrative captures the emotional world of childhood while offering thoughtful guidance on ethical living. Her storytelling balances imagination with moral insight, allowing young readers to appreciate the joys of discovery and the value of good character.
This classic work continues to appeal to readers interested in traditional children’s literature, moral storytelling, and the rich literary heritage of the Victorian era.
